Bill Summary
More Water, More Energy, and Less Waste Act of 2007 - Directs the Secretary of the Interior, acting through the Commissioner of Reclamation, the Director of the U.S. Geological Survey, and the Director of the Bureau of Land Management (BLM), to conduct a study to identify: (1) the obstacles to reducing the quantity of produced water (water from an underground source that is brought to the surface as part of the exploration for or development...
